Adam Winkler: Gun Control Through History
From the Founding Fathers and the Second Amendment to the origins of the Klan (ironically, as a gun-control organization), the debate over guns always has generated controversy. In the tradition of Gideon's Trumpet, constitutional law expert Adam Winkler, author of Gunfight, examines America's centuries-long political battle over gun control and the right to bear arms using the 2008 case District of Columbia v. Heller (which invalidated a law banning handguns in the nation's capital) as a springboard. Presented by the Town Hall Center for Civic Life with Elliott Bay Book Company.
